The South Shore Tassio 6-Drawer Double Dresser in Weathered Oak combines rustic charm with practical storage solutions. With six spacious drawers capable of holding up to 25 pounds each, this dresser is designed for durability and ease of use. Its large top surface is perfect for everyday items, while the 5-year limited warranty ensures your investment is protected. Ideal for any bedroom, this piece is both stylish and functional.

Great value option
This is a good option for someone looking to make more storage space available for their clothes or otherwise. It's inexpensive and relatively easy to assemble. The particle board is quite sturdy and was mostly free from chips and defects.Obviously this isn't a five-star quality item, but it gets the job done. Some of the cons to this item are the finish and the flexibility of the unit. One of the main boards (the center one at that) arrived too tall, and was just long enough to make the whole unit wobble from side to side. Once fully assembled I found out that I can actually spin this unit on the center board when balanced correctly. Yes, this unit spins with a little push because the center board is too tall. That's downright awful fit and finish, but it didn't end there. The unit is very flexible and each board tries to detach itself from its siblings when you push, pull, or lift the unit to move it into place. I had to reassemble an entire wall because it completely detached itself from the rest of the unit once we tried to stand it up. That's another thing - this requires two people in order to assemble quickly and with less headaches.Overall 3 stars, but in a good kind of way. It beats the price of the similar options from Ikea and from Walmart's brand, is of decent quality, and has generally more storage volume than the similarly priced competitors. The balancing issues are easy to resolve by sanding down the central piece a bit, and the flexibility isn't a problem when you're not trying to move the unit from its location. The drawers are good and sturdy and fit nicely. I'd buy again.

AMAZING PRODUCT- BUT READ THE INSTRUCTIONS
OK.. if you are considering purchasing, this will be the BEST bit of info you will read.1. This product, if built according to the instructions, is PHENOMINAL. Sturdy. Great.2. What we did not know until we were in the final stages of putting it together... The drawers are DIFFERENT HEIGHTS. So if you put the taller drawer in the smaller slot, it WONT fit. So you will think it wasnt put together correctly. The TALLER drawers go at the bottom. REMEMBER THAT.3. Kind of goes along with #2... I saw a lot of reviews saying the drawers didnt close well, and that they didnt fit. I guarantee you 100% that its because the taller drawers were not at the bottom. Just keep that in mind. VERY easy fix.4. The dresser is heavy. Very sturdy. Definitely recommend.It didnt take any longer to put this together than it would any other dresser. The color is gorgeous. And for what you pay for it? DEFINITELY worth it.Now go get your dresser!
